### [Ownable](/near-plugins/src/ownable.rs)

Basic access control mechanism that allows _only_ an authorized account id to call certain methods. Note this account
id can belong either to a regular user, or it could be a contract (a DAO for example).
Basic access control mechanism that allows _only_ an authorized account id to call certain methods. Note this account id can belong either to a regular user, or it could be a contract (a DAO for example).

Contract example using _Ownable_ plugin.
[This contract](/near-plugins/tests/contracts/ownable/src/lib.rs) provides an example of using `Ownable`. It is compiled, deployed on chain and interacted with in [integration tests](/near-plugins/tests/ownable.rs).

```rust
#[near_bindgen]
#[derive(Ownable)]
struct Counter {
counter: u64,
}

#[near_bindgen]
impl Counter {
/// Specify the owner of the contract in the constructor
#[init]
fn new() -> Self {
let mut contract = Self { counter: 0 };
contract.owner_set(Some(near_sdk::env::predecessor_account_id()));
contract
}

/// Only owner account, or the contract itself can call this method.
#[only(self, owner)]
fn protected(&mut self) {
self.counter += 1;
}

/// *Only* owner account can call this method.
#[only(owner)]
fn protected_owner(&mut self) {
self.counter += 1;
}

/// *Only* self account can call this method. This can be used even if the contract is not Ownable.
#[only(self)]
fn protected_self(&mut self) {
self.counter += 1;
}

/// Everyone can call this method
fn unprotected(&mut self) {
self.counter += 1;
}
}
```
